Looking for performance/reliability suggestions for an 02 GTP. I am racing in a circuit track, full contact snow/ice race in January.
Any weak spots i need to protect or reinforce?
Spare parts I need to bring with?
What about common parts failures and weak points throughout whole car.
There are virtually zero restrictions for this race. Going against cars/suvs/pickups/subarus etc.... Last years top 3 were a Minicooper and an 2-S10's

The added weight of bumpers is killing suspension height. I need to find a way to lift the front and rear ~2"
 
New coil springs would likely raise it up if they are the factory 18 year old springs.

Keep the transmission in 2nd gear to keep it alive. If it's allowed to upshift into 3rd and 4th you will just kill it faster. The 2nd gear goes all the way to 80mph anyway.

Make sure the tie rod ends and controls arms are in good shape. Don't want that breaking right away. The control arm bushings are known to pull through the arm when they are really worn out.

Step up to some 5W40 oil too and dump a whole 5 quarts in there. I think the manual says it's 4.5 quarts but the half quart extra is a good idea.
